Aside from the smtpd logs, do you also have qmail logs. I'm not sure about your installation but with my installation using daemontools my qmail logs are under /service/qmail/logs/main/current and smtpd logs are under /service/qmail/logs/main/current.
Most details of errors can actually be seen on qmail logs.
